Abstract

The present invention relates to an integrating ramp circuit with reduced ramp settling time. The ramp generator includes an integrator including a first stage and a second stage, wherein the first stage has a first input and a second input, and a first output and a second output, and the second stage A first transistor and a second transistor are included that are coupled between the power rail and ground. The node between the first transistor and the second transistor is coupled to the output of the integrator amplifier. The control terminal of the first transistor is coupled to the first output of the first stage, and the control terminal of the second transistor is coupled to the second output of the first stage. During a ramp event in the ramp signal generated from the output, a first current flows from the output to ground. A trim circuit is coupled to the output of the integrator amplifier to provide a second current to the output of the integrator amplifier in response to the trim input. The second current substantially matches the first current.

Description

technical field [0001] The present invention relates generally to image sensors, and in particular, but not limited to, comparator output circuits for analog-to-digital conversion in image sensors. Background technique [0002] Image sensors have become ubiquitous. They are widely used in digital cameras, cellular phones, security cameras, as well as in medical, automotive and other applications. The technology used to manufacture image sensors has been evolving at a rapid pace. For example, the need for higher resolution and lower power consumption encourages further miniaturization and integration of these devices. [0003] Image sensors typically receive light on an array of pixels, which creates an electrical charge in the pixels. The intensity of light can affect the amount of charge generated in each pixel, with higher intensities generating higher amounts of charge.
